    Thank you very much for answering. I’ll make my own mod. Different from Chris.
    Only cover the graphics processor and a small copper block with three heatpipes sintered 1mm thick x 8 x 100 mm at the top.
    Each heatpipe holds 12w dissipation, cost 10 euros each. It will take time to arrive because I live in Spain and only sold in USA.

    The copper block will be 0.5mm thick and the copper plate that will be in contact with the processor will also 0.5mm. I will use a cutting machine CNC computer to make it all the more necessary.

    Each heatpipe anger copper plates connected at the other end for transferring heat from the processor.

    In short, my idea is to replicate the scale of our cube i7 book the same passive cooling system that has the Microsoft Surface Pro 4 with Core m3.

    Muchas gracias por responder. Yo voy a fabricar mi propio mod. Diferente al de Chris. Solo cubrira el procesador y la grafica un pequeño bloque de cobre con tres heatpipes sintered de 1mm de grosor x 8 x 100 mm en la parte superior.

    Cada heatpipe aguanta 12w de disipacion, cuestan 10 euros cada uno. Tardara tiempo en llegar porque vivo en España y solo los venden en USA.

    El bloque de cobre sera de 0,5mm de grosor y la placa de cobre que estara en contacto con el procesador sera de 0,5mm tambien. Usare una maquina de corte por ordenador CNC para que sea todo sea mas preciso.

    Cada heatpipe ira conectado a placas de cobre en el otro extremo para transferir el calor del procesador.

    En resumen, mi idea es replicar a la escala de nuestras cube i7 book el mismo sistema de refrigeración pasiva que tiene la Microsoft Pro 4 con el Core m3

     

    Los materiales necesarios:

    . 1 x 50x50x0,5mm placa de cobre.

    . 3 x Heat Sinks STRAIGHT ULTRA THIN 5mmX100mm HEAT PIPE. Modelo Wakefield-Vette Heat Pipes.

    . 1 x 200x200x0,2mm placa de cobre. (para disipar el calor de los heatpipes)

    . Cinta aislante gruesa para evitar cortocircuitos.

    . Pasta termica Artic MX-4.

    . Pegamento termico para unir disipador y heatpipes.

    . 1x 25x17cm Lamina de fibra de carbono o vidrio para aislar de calor los componentes, sobre todo la batería.

    After much work getting it Open i finaly made a Small thermal Mod on this Tablet. I have put a thermal Pad on the Metal on the Board and closed it again. Without this and a Short Stress Test with Prime 95 i got over 100°! With the Mod it is 74° so a good improvement. I also want to make some editing with the Intel Tuning Programm.
